description 碩士 === 大同大學 === 機械工程學系(所) === 95 === Modern production status gradually takes small batch, diversification, short delivery date, production by order as trend of development. Under this production status, how to reduce the stock cost and delivery delay, shorten manufacture flow time and enhances the effective utilization of the production resource becomes the current problem to be solved. Therefore, this paper takes「the electrical appliances and refrigerator factory」as an example to discuss implements of ‘fine really to produce’ to wholly improve production and manufacture. 『Lean Production』based on JIT matches the 5S foundation movement and unifies TQC, TPM staff training activities to improve the increased manufacturing cost of the traditional factory on implementing small batch production. The research is by the small batch production pattern and takes same-contents of refrigerators to make comparison on the production data before improvement year (87–89) and those production methods and layout after improvement year (92–94) through e.g. stock amount, the manufacture flow time, model change, the transporting time, the equipment available rate and the good quality rate and so on. After process comparison, finally it proves『Lean Production』makes the stock amount reduction the biggest profit ex all execution for the refrigerator factory. The total stock amount takes whole manufacturing expenses from the originally 55.8% down to 19.01%. The next is the production process time 37.9% reduction and every year may save 5.29% expenses in the production cost. Herein, this proves the electrical appliances refrigerator factory’s implements『Lean Production』will promote industrial competitive competence.
